May 20 Canada Flight Disruptions Across Major Airports Impact Airlines

May 20 Canada Flight Disruptions Across Major Airports Impact Airlines

0
On May 20, 2026, Canada’s major airports including Calgary, Montreal, Ottawa, Toronto, and Vancouver experienced 44 flight cancellations and 213 delays. Air Canada, WestJet, Porter Airlines, and other carriers faced wide operational disruptions impacting domestic and regional services.

Thousands of US Flights Delayed Today Amid FAA Staffing Shortages

4,896 US Flights Delayed, 126 Cancelled on July 18 Amid FAA Staffing and Smoke

0
On July 18, 2026, nearly 4,900 US flights were delayed and 126 cancelled due to FAA staffing shortages and Canadian wildfire smoke impact. Chicago O’Hare Airport reported the highest disruptions with 801 delays and 17 cancellations.
